== English ==
=== Etymology ===
From or equivalent to banat, banate, the territory of a ban (“leader”).
=== Proper noun ===
Banat
(historical) A geographical region of Central Europe, now spread over three countries: an eastern, greater part in Romania, a western part in Serbia (mostly in Vojvodina) and a small northwestern part in Hungary.
